Block

#21,917,433
Block Number
21,917,433 @ 06/12/2025, 04:46:40
Status
Finalized
ID
0x014e6ef901bcc64e79c88696ccf0af1dbf2121eb2d2288364fce2b3a903ab388
Transactions
Gas Used
8102240/40000000 (20.26% Used)
Total Score
2,140,572,905 (+98)
Rewards
33.58 VTHO